From 79592103e08c5ca5f1c99df7a2a9b512b728f00b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Brian McMahon Date: Mon, 25 May 2026 11:08:37 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] feat(cost-telemetry): runaway-cost circuit breaker on news pipeline (Phase 4 #1) M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Mirrors alpha-engine-research's ``llm_cost_tracker.RunBudgetExceededError`` pattern at the news-pipeline cost site (Phase 0.2 wiring, PR #308): ``S3CostBuffer.record()`` now tracks cumulative cost across the run and raises ``CostBudgetExceededError`` after recording the offending row if the per-run total exceeds ``ALPHA_ENGINE_RUN_BUDGET_USD`` (default $100, shared env var with research + executor — one operator knob ceilings cost across all SF entry points). **Failure shape:** row is recorded BEFORE the raise so per-call detail is preserved on S3 when the breaker fires. The pipeline-side try/finally in ``run_news_pipeline.py`` ensures the buffer flushes even when the breaker raises mid-loop — rows up to and including the breach call land on S3 so operators can diagnose what broke the budget without re-running. **Posture:** breaker propagates through the client proxy (``_CostTrackingMessages.create``) — generic record errors still get swallowed (event extraction's primary deliverable must survive a malformed-response hiccup), but ``CostBudgetExceededError`` is explicitly re-raised since swallowing it would defeat the safety net. **Operator-facing fields on the error:** ``run_id``, ``agent_id``, ``cumulative_cost_usd``, ``ceiling_usd``. Message tells operator how to adjust the env var if the ceiling needs raising. **Tests:** 4 ``TestRunBudgetCeilingResolution`` (default / env / zero disables / malformed-returns-zero) + 5 ``TestCostBudgetBreaker`` (under-ceiling no raise, breach raises after recording row, zero disables, proxy propagates, ceiling defaults from env). Suite 1484 → 1493 passing, zero regressions. **Composes with** PR #308 (the Phase 0.2 wiring) — the breaker is a small additive surface on the buffer; the production wiring path unchanged.
